Common Garage Door Repair Scams in Maryville
Be aware of these tactic used by unlicensed operators
Fake Emergency Door Service
Scammers cold-call or knock claiming your garage door is unsafe and needs instant repair, often after a storm.
Bait-and-Switch Pricing
Quotes a low price to hook you, then 'discovers' expensive issues onsite, doubling or tripling the cost.
Unnecessary Parts Replacement
Insists torsion springs or openers must be replaced immediately, even if minor fix would do—charges premium for fake urgency.
Phantom Damage Upsell
During service, claims hidden damage requiring full door replacement, vanishing after deposit.
How to Verify a Professional
Insurance
Ask for a current certificate of insurance (COI) listing general liability and workers' comp. Call their insurer to confirm it's active and covers your job.
Licensing
In Illinois, verify contractor registration via the IDFPR website or Madison County Building Department. Search the business name on official state and county sites—legit pros provide license numbers gladly.
References
Request at least 3 recent Maryville-area references. Call them to ask about work quality, timeliness, and if they'd hire again.
